首页 资讯文章正文

搭建图片风格迁移网站,技术探索与实际应用,探索与实现,图片风格迁移网站搭建之路

资讯 2025年02月02日 17:49 37 admin
搭建图片风格迁移网站,涉及技术探索和实际应用。该网站利用深度学习技术实现风格迁移,用户可上传图片,选择风格进行转换。项目不仅探讨了算法优化,还结合实际需求,为艺术创作、设计等领域提供便捷工具,推动风格迁移技术在现实中的应用。

随着人工智能技术的飞速发展,图像风格迁移技术逐渐成为计算机视觉领域的研究热点,图片风格迁移技术可以将一张图片的风格迁移到另一张图片上,实现艺术创作、图像编辑等多种应用,本文将探讨如何搭建一个基于深度学习的图片风格迁移网站,并分析其技术实现和实际应用。

技术背景

1、图像风格迁移技术

图像风格迁移技术是指将一张图片的风格(如色彩、纹理等)迁移到另一张图片上,使目标图片具有源图片的风格,近年来,基于深度学习的图像风格迁移技术取得了显著成果,主要分为以下几种:

(1)基于卷积神经网络(CNN)的方法:通过训练一个深度网络,将源图片的风格特征提取出来,并将其迁移到目标图片上。

(2)基于生成对抗网络(GAN)的方法:通过训练一个生成器和判别器,使生成器能够生成具有源图片风格的图像。

2、深度学习平台

搭建图片风格迁移网站需要使用深度学习平台,如TensorFlow、PyTorch等,这些平台提供了丰富的工具和库,方便开发者进行模型训练和部署。

搭建图片风格迁移网站

1、网站架构

(1)前端:使用HTML、CSS和JavaScript等技术,实现用户界面和交互功能。

(2)后端:使用Python、Java等编程语言,搭建服务器,处理用户请求,调用深度学习模型进行风格迁移。

(3)模型训练:使用TensorFlow或PyTorch等深度学习平台,训练风格迁移模型。

2、技术实现

(1)前端实现

前端主要实现用户界面和交互功能,包括:

- 用户上传源图片和目标图片;

- 显示风格迁移结果;

- 提供下载迁移后的图片功能。

(2)后端实现

后端主要处理用户请求,调用深度学习模型进行风格迁移,包括:

- 接收用户上传的图片;

- 将图片传递给深度学习模型进行风格迁移;

- 将迁移后的图片返回给前端显示。

(3)模型训练

使用TensorFlow或PyTorch等深度学习平台,训练风格迁移模型,包括:

- 数据准备:收集大量的风格迁移数据,包括源图片和目标图片;

- 模型设计:设计合适的网络结构,如VGG19、ResNet等;

- 训练过程:使用Adam优化器、交叉熵损失函数等,训练模型。

3、部署与优化

(1)部署

将训练好的模型部署到服务器上,实现实时风格迁移。

(2)优化

- 优化模型结构,提高迁移效果;

- 优化服务器性能,提高网站响应速度;

- 提供多种风格迁移选项,满足用户需求。

实际应用

1、艺术创作

图片风格迁移技术可以应用于艺术创作,如将一张照片的风格迁移到名画风格,实现独特的艺术效果。

2、图像编辑

在图像编辑领域,图片风格迁移技术可以用于调整图片的色调、纹理等,提高图片的美观度。

3、媒体制作

在媒体制作过程中,图片风格迁移技术可以用于制作具有特定风格的视频、动画等。

搭建图片风格迁移网站是一个具有挑战性的任务,需要掌握深度学习、前端和后端开发等技术,通过本文的探讨,我们了解到如何搭建这样一个网站,并分析了其技术实现和实际应用,随着人工智能技术的不断发展,图片风格迁移技术将在更多领域发挥重要作用。

标签: 图片风格迁移 网站搭建

上海衡基裕网络科技有限公司,网络热门最火问答,www.tdkwl.com网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868